Common Wood Windows Installation Jobs
Wood window replacement - upgrading existing windows to improve energ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Custom wood window installation - adding unique or historically accurate wood windows to enhance architectural style.
Historic wood window restoration - preserving and restoring original wood windows for character and authenticity.
Double-hung wood window installation - providing versatile, easy-to-operate windows for ventilation and style.
Casement wood window setup - installing windows that open outward for maximum airflow and natural light.
Picture window wood installation - creating large, unobstructed views with fixed wood window designs.
Wood Windows Installation Questions
What types of wood windows are available for installation? There are various sty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ows, suitable for different aesthetic and functional preferences.
Can wood windows be customized to match existing home styles? Yes, wood windows can be customized in size, finish, and design to complement the architecture of a home or property.
What is involved in the installation process for wood windows? The process typically includes measuring, removing old windows, preparing the opening, and securely installing the new wood windows for proper operation.
Are wood windows suitable for all types of properties? Wood windows are versatile and can enhance both historic and modern properties, offering durability and aesthetic appeal.
